Frequency of partial examinations set by the owner of the building, the operating organization, depending on the design features of the building and the technical condition of its elements. 12. Unscheduled Inspections should be conducted after natural disasters, accidents and the detection of harmful strains reason. 13. General inspections of buildings made commissions, including: chairman of the commission – director (Deputy Head, Chief Engineer) organization, committee members – those responsible for systematic monitoring of the operation of buildings and structures, the representatives of the in charge of the operation of certain types of engineering equipment, department heads, production facilities, shops, offices and a pile of safety and other departments directly operating the building, a trade union representative. To work Commission experts may be involved, experts and representatives of the construction and repair organizations.

14. The results of all examinations are issued regulations, which marked the defects found, as well as the necessary measures to address them with a timetable of works. The act is signed by all members of the commission and approved by the owner of the building or his authorized representative. 15. The results of all inspections should also be reflected in documents account the technical condition of the building (the magazine of technical building maintenance, data sheet). These documents should include: assessment of technical condition of the building and its individual elements, the location and parameters of the detected defects, their causes and possible solutions. 16. If you find minor defects in structures should be organized for constant monitoring of their development, give reasons of the degree of danger to the continued operation of the building and identify possible solutions.
